Why Growing Schools Matter

Growing cannabis isn’t just about planting seeds and watering them. It’s a complex process that involves understanding the plant's biology, managing environmental factors, and knowing how to troubleshoot common problems like pests and nutrient deficiencies. That’s where growing schools come in. At CSC School, students gain in-depth knowledge and practical skills, allowing them to grow cannabis effectively and consistently.

Career Opportunities After Attending Growing Schools

The cannabis industry offers a variety of career paths for those with cultivation skills. After completing CSC School’s growing programs, graduates are equipped to pursue a range of opportunities. Here are some potential career options:

  1. Cannabis Grower

Work directly with cannabis plants, managing the cultivation process from start to finish. This is a critical role in any cannabis production operation.

  1. Cultivation Manager

Oversee the entire growing operation, including managing a team of growers, ensuring compliance with state regulations, and maximizing yield efficiency.

  1. Cannabis Consultant

Provide expert advice to cannabis growers on how to optimize their growing operations, troubleshoot problems, and ensure compliance with industry standards.

  1. Seed Bank Specialist

Work with cannabis seed companies to develop and sell high-quality cannabis seeds to growers and dispensaries.

  1. Cannabis Educator

Teach classes on growing weed or become a mentor for new growers entering the cannabis industry.
